From 253e91d8fb5f1165a76242a413a5747a8ce53bc5 Mon Sep 17 00:00:00 2001 From: ajisaka Date: Thu, 25 Jul 2024 21:21:59 +0900 Subject: [PATCH] Preserve line break codes (#169) https://docs.python.org/3/library/functions.html#open --- bump_pydantic/main.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/bump_pydantic/main.py b/bump_pydantic/main.py index 640b827..3558db0 100644 --- a/bump_pydantic/main.py +++ b/bump_pydantic/main.py @@ -182,7 +182,7 @@ def run_codemods( context.scratch.update(scratch) file_path = Path(filename) - with file_path.open("r+", encoding="utf-8") as fp: + with file_path.open("r+", encoding="utf-8", newline="") as fp: code = fp.read() fp.seek(0)